Historical Context & Motivation
The problem of commonly confused words is not a modern invention; it is woven into the very DNA of the English language. English evolved through successive waves of invasion, colonization, and cultural contact—each depositing a stratum of vocabulary that frequently produced pairs or clusters of words nearly identical in sound yet divergent in meaning. The Great Vowel Shift of the fifteenth and sixteenth centuries collapsed many once-distinct pronunciations, creating new homophones and near-homophones that writers have struggled with ever since. Because the HESI A2 Grammar section specifically tests your ability to choose the correct word in clinical and academic contexts, understanding why English is so rife with these pitfalls can sharpen the vigilance you bring to each test item.
The central question the HESI A2 Grammar section poses is deceptively simple: Can you reliably distinguish between words that sound alike or look alike but mean different things? The stakes in healthcare communication are high; confusing accept and except in a clinical note could alter the meaning of an order or care plan. High-Yield Confusable Pairs for the HESI A2
While the English language contains hundreds of confusable pairs, the HESI A2 focuses on a curated subset that appears with high frequency. The table below covers the pairs most likely to appear on test day, organized by confusion type. For each pair, the table provides the correct definition, part of speech, and a mnemonic anchor to cement the distinction.
| Word A | Word B | Key Distinction | Mnemonic |
|---|---|---|---|
| affect (verb) | effect (noun) | Affect = to influence; effect = a result | A for Action (verb), E for End result (noun) |
| accept (verb) | except (prep/conj) | Accept = to receive willingly; except = excluding | Accept has 'ac-' like 'acquire'; except has 'ex-' like 'exclude' |
| than (conj) | then (adverb) | Than = comparison; then = time sequence | ThAn for compArison; thEn for whEn |
| its (possessive) | it's (contraction) | Its = belonging to it; it's = it is or it has | Expand: if 'it is' works, use the apostrophe |
| who's (contraction) | whose (possessive) | Who's = who is; whose = belonging to whom | Same test as its/it's: expand the contraction |
| principal (n/adj) | principle (noun) | Principal = chief/main or a leader; principle = a rule or doctrine | The principAL is your pAL; a principLE is a ruLE |
| complement (n/v) | compliment (n/v) | Complement = to complete; compliment = to praise | ComplementE complEtes; compliment = 'I like you' |
| farther (adv) | further (adv/adj) | Farther = physical distance; further = metaphorical extent | FARther = FAR (physical); fUrther = fUrthermore (abstract) |
| lie (intransitive v) | lay (transitive v) | Lie = to recline (no object); lay = to put down (requires object) | LAY requires something to plAce; LIE = I recline |
| fewer (adj) | less (adj) | Fewer = countable items; less = uncountable quantity | Fewer pills (count them); less pain (measure it) |

Common Traps & How to Avoid Them
Beyond individual word pairs, the HESI A2 also tests broader usage errors that arise from grammatical confusion rather than simple homophony. The table below contrasts several categories of traps with the strategies that neutralize them. Recognizing these patterns at the structural level will allow you to work through unfamiliar items even when the specific word pair has not been memorized.
| Trap Category | How It Misleads | Resolution Strategy |
|---|---|---|
| Contraction vs. Possessive | Apostrophes can signal either possession or a contraction, making pairs like its/it's, your/you're, and their/they're ambiguous at first glance. | Always expand the contraction. If 'it is' or 'you are' makes sense, use the apostrophe form; otherwise, use the possessive. |
| Transitive vs. Intransitive Verbs | Pairs like lie/lay and sit/set differ in whether they take a direct object. Writers often use the transitive form when no object is present. | Check for a direct object after the verb. If there is one, use the transitive form (lay, set, raise); if not, use the intransitive form (lie, sit, rise). |
| Count vs. Non-Count Nouns | Words like fewer/less, number/amount, and many/much depend on whether the noun is countable. Casual speech blurs these lines. | Ask: can I put a specific number in front of the noun? 'Five patients' = countable → fewer/number/many. 'Some fluid' = uncountable → less/amount/much. |
| Direction of Action | Pairs like imply/infer and emigrate/immigrate have mirror-image directionality. The speaker implies; the listener infers. You emigrate from a country; you immigrate to one. | Identify who is performing the action and in which direction. Mnemonics with directional prefixes help: e- = exit, im- = into; im-ply = put in, in-fer = take in. |
| Adjective vs. Adverb | Using 'good' when 'well' is needed, or 'bad' when 'badly' is correct. These are not homophones but are confused because of overlap in informal speech. | Adjectives modify nouns; adverbs modify verbs, adjectives, or other adverbs. If the word describes how an action is performed, use the adverb form. |
Connection to Graduate-Level Writing & Clinical Practice
The HESI A2 Grammar section is a gatekeeper, but the skills it tests become even more consequential once you enter a graduate health sciences program. Clinical documentation, research abstracts, and interprofessional communications all demand the same precision. The table below maps HESI A2 word-confusion skills to their graduate-level and professional counterparts, illustrating how mastery at this stage pays dividends throughout your career.
| HESI A2 Skill | Graduate-Level Application | Clinical Practice Implication |
|---|---|---|
| Distinguishing affect/effect | Writing literature reviews where 'affect' appears as a psychology noun and 'effect' as a research outcome | Charting "medication affected patient's HR" vs. "side effect noted"—ambiguity could lead to missed follow-up |
| Resolving contraction vs. possessive | Thesis-level writing requires elimination of contractions entirely; possessive accuracy remains critical | Contractions are generally prohibited in formal clinical documentation; misuse signals unprofessional communication |
| Applying fewer/less correctly | Quantitative research demands precise language about count data vs. continuous measures | "Fewer adverse events" vs. "less inflammation"—correct usage signals mastery of evidence-based practice language |
| Choosing imply vs. infer | Critical appraisal of literature: "The authors imply..." vs. "We can infer..." | In interdisciplinary team discussions, confusing these can misrepresent clinical reasoning to colleagues |
As you progress into graduate coursework, you will encounter additional confusable pairs specific to clinical and scientific writing—adverse vs. averse, discreet vs. discrete, proscribe vs. prescribe. The diagnostic framework you build now—part-of-speech analysis, substitution testing, and mnemonic anchoring—will transfer directly to these higher-stakes contexts. Lesson Summary
Commonly confused words on the HESI A2 fall into four categories: homophones (identical pronunciation, different spelling and meaning), near-homophones (nearly identical sound with overlapping meanings), semantic confusables (different sound but overlapping meaning), and morphological traps (shared root with different prefixes or suffixes). The most dangerous pairs are those with both high phonetic similarity and high semantic overlap—such as affect/effect—because both ear and intuition can mislead you.
To resolve any confused-word item efficiently, apply the four-step diagnostic protocol: (1) read for meaning, (2) identify the part of speech the sentence requires, (3) substitute each candidate's definition into the blank to test fit, and (4) confirm with a mnemonic anchor. Key high-yield pairs include accept/except, its/it's, than/then, lie/lay, and fewer/less. These skills transfer directly to graduate-level clinical documentation where precision in word choice has direct implications for patient safety and professional credibility.
